  • Patent number: 4946743
    Abstract: A coextruded heat sealable film made with nonoriented polyester and a heat seal layer comprising about 50% to about 80% of a copolyester and about 20% to about 50% of an olefin polymer is disclosed. In one preferred embodiment the polyester base layer includes from about 1% to about 5% of a polyolefin, LLDPE being preferred; and in another preferred embodiment the polyester base layer comprises a resin which is a nonoriented film form has a tensile strength of 7,000 psi or more. The heat sealable film can be laminated with aluminum foil, paper, etc. to form a composite which is heat sealable, useful in pouches and lidding stock. The heat seal layer using about 30% to about 40% LLDPE as the olefin polymer is particularly useful when the film is laminated to aluminum foil and heat sealed as lidding stock to crystallized CPET trays.

  • Patent number: 4765999
    Abstract: Multiple layer nonoriented heat sealable films are disclosed having a base substrate layer of poly(ethylene terephthalate) (polyester) or polyester copolymer and at least one heat sealable surface layer of a copolyester. The films are prepared by conventional cast or blown film coextrusion techniques.

  • Patent number: 4716061
    Abstract: A nonoriented, heat sealable, coextruded, moisture barrier film is disclosed. This film has a base layer ("A") of polypropylene homopolymer, polypropylene copolymer or combinations thereof, a heat sealant layer ("C") of polyester/copolyester or blends thereof and a tie layer ("B") of modified polyethylene homopolymer, modified polyethylene copolymer, modified polypropylene homopolymer, modified polypropylene copolymer, an unmodified polyethylene copolymer or combinations thereof between the base layer ("A") and the heat sealant layer ("C"). This film has three layers ("ABC") or five layers ("CBABC"). This film exhibits a very broad heat seal range and has a moisture vapor transmission rate of from about 0.20 to about 1.0 g/100in.sup.2 /24 hr. This film has a wide variety of applications as a packaging film including such demanding uses as the inside of a microwave popcorn bag. This film significantly improves the shelf life of microwave popcorn compared to conventional films used for this product.

  • Patent number: 4705707
    Abstract: A nonoriented, heat sealable, coextruded, moisture barrier film is disclosed. This film has a base layer ("A") of polyethylene, preferably high density, a heat sealant layer ("C") of polyester/copolyester or blends thereof and a tie layer ("B") of modified polyethylene homopolymer, modified polyethylene copolymer, unmodified polyethylene copolymer or combinations thereof between the base layer ("A") and the heat sealant layer ("C"). This film has three layers ("ABC") or five layers ("CBABC"). This film exhibits a very broad heat seal range and has a moisture vapor transmission rate of from about 0.20 to about 1.0 g/100 in.sup.2 /24 hr. This film has a wide variety of applications as a packaging film including such demanding uses as the inside of a microwave popcorn bag. This film significantly improves the shelf life of microwave popcorn compared to conventional films used for this product. This film also exhibits excellent heat seal properties to itself as well as a wide variety of diverse substrates.

  • Patent number: 4394473
    Abstract: Bales of unvulcanized rubber, vulcanized rubber or compounding ingredients for unvulcanized rubber are packaged in film or bags made from syndiotactic 1,2-polybutadiene (1,2-SBD) containing at least one antiblock agent additive and at least one slip agent additive. Coextrusion can be used to manufacture bags or film having two or more layers where only the inside layer is heavily loaded with antiblock additives and the outside layer contains only a minimal amount of antiblock additives with both layers containing slip agents. The use of 1,2-SBD serves to eliminate the problems of incompatibility and disposal encountered in the prior art and provides film and bags having superior puncture and tear resistance when compared to a conventional material such as polyethylene.
